Core Viewpoint - Vanke, once a top performer in the industry, is at a critical juncture regarding its liquidity crisis, highlighted by the upcoming bond repayment deadline on December 15, 2025 [3][4]. Group 1: Bondholder Meeting and Proposals - Vanke announced a second bondholder meeting on December 18, 2025, to discuss repayment arrangements for the "22 Vanke MTN004" bond, which is currently in a 5-day grace period [4]. - The first bondholder meeting's proposals for extending the bond repayment were all rejected, with the original proposal receiving zero votes in favor, and the closest alternative proposal falling short by 6.6 percentage points of the required 90% approval [6]. - The second meeting is crucial as it will determine whether Vanke can successfully negotiate an extension of the bond repayment, which is essential for avoiding a potential default [4][6]. Group 2: Market Reaction and Financial Pressure - Following the news, Vanke's bonds experienced significant declines, with "21 Vanke 02" dropping over 24% and "23 Vanke 01" and "22 Vanke 04" also seeing notable decreases [5]. - As of November 2025, Vanke has a total of 18.2 billion yuan in domestic debt principal and interest due within a year, with 5.7 billion yuan due in December alone, indicating a substantial liquidity pressure [7]. - The company faces a funding gap exceeding 60% for the current period, as the available loan amount from Shenzhen Metro Group is only 2.29 billion yuan [7].
